Details Find out more about disciplinary … WebA summary dismissal letter is a formal way of conveying an employee summary dismissal. You can include the dismissal letter as part of your evidence of a fair process. A good summary dismissal letter should include: The decision to dismiss the employee and how you came to that conclusion. The nature of gross misconduct.
